Take Jack Davis… please! And keep him, GOP

Thanks to The Albany Project for this nugget. Jack Davis, the Republican-turned Democrat, the build-a-higher-wall to keep Mexicans away from our American Jobs industrialist, the man who paid canvassers to collect signatures to create a new 3rd party for himself and then botched his own paperwork, the man who did more to elect Christopher Lee to Congress, than, hmmm, Christopher Lee, the man who marched, er, drove his car in parades, the man who tried to bribe his way onto the Independence Party ballot line, the man who paid all of his campaign expenses because nobody else would contribute a penny, the man who tried to buy votes one gas tank at a time, the man who took his case to the Supreme Court and won the right for rich dudes to outspend their Clean Money opponents …. yup, THAT Jack Davis… might be getting ready to switch back to Republican.

Over at TAP, Robert Harding’s reaction:

Not that I’m in the business of consulting the Republicans, but I would be a little concerned if this switch goes down. The last time Davis switched parties, it was because he paid money to see Dick Cheney and never got a sit-down with him. That led to him becoming a Democrat and the disastrous three runs for Congress on the Democratic Party line.

I know some Democrats might be upset because Davis isn’t around to cut them checks anymore, but this is a great day for our party if this turns out to be true.

As the song goes, hit the road, Jack, and don’t you come back.
